Decadent subjects : the idea of decadence in art, literature, philosophy, and culture of the fin de siècle in Europe /

Annotation Charles Bernheimer described decadence as a "stimulant that bends thought out of shape, deforming traditional conceptual molds." In this posthumously published work, Bernheimer succeeds in making a critical concept out of this perennially fashionable, rarely understood term. Dec...
